About The Position

We’re seeking an experienced Traffic Anchor to keep listeners informed with timely, accurate traffic and weather updates across the local area. Because Honolulu has its own unique roadway culture and naming conventions, this Anchor must understand — or be able to quickly learn — the specific ways locals refer to highways, landmarks, and key routes.

Requirements

  • Proficient in Microsoft Office, including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and SharePoint.
  • Strong knowledge of local geography, major roadways, mass transit systems, and traffic patterns.
  • Clear, pleasant, and well‑controlled on‑air voice with excellent pronunciation.
  • Skilled at working in a fast‑paced, deadline‑driven, newsroom‑style environment.
  • Excellent writing and editing abilities with strong command of grammar.
  • Exceptional attention to detail with consistent follow‑through until issues are resolved.
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to prioritize and multitask effectively in a high‑volume setting.

Nice To Haves

  • Familiarity with police scanners is a plus.
  • Previous broadcast experience pre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Provide timely, accurate, and useful information to help commuters plan their drives.
  • Deliver up‑to‑the‑minute reports on accidents, delays, and major traffic disruptions.
  • Read traffic updates, commercials, and public service announcements on air.
  • Gather information from multiple intake sources and monitor local, state, and national traffic feeds to determine what’s most relevant.
  • Research, write, and produce traffic and weather copy for on‑air use; edit audio using digital editing software.
  • Manage incoming information, verify facts, and ensure all details are accurate and current; maintain updated content on station websites.
  • Create written, visual, audio, and video content for websites, blogs, and social media platforms.
  • Work a flexible schedule as needed, which may include early mornings, evenings, weekends, or holidays.
